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Cabrera s Hutia | Greater Long-tongued Bat |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(동물) | Animalia (동물)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(척삭동물) | Chordata (척삭동물) |
| Class same | Mammalia (포유류) | Mammalia (포유류) |
| Order | Rodentia (설치류) | Chiroptera (박쥐) |
| Family | Capromyidae | Phyllostomidae |
| Genus | Mesocapromys | Choeroniscus |
| Species | Mesocapromys angelcabrerai | Choeroniscus periosus |
Evolutionary Relationship
Cabrera s Hutia and Greater Long-tongued Bat share a common ancestor at the Class level: Mammalia. (포유류)
